Web16 Feb 2024 · The Ascidiacea are the Sea Squirts or Tunicates and they make up the bulk of the species found within the Urochordata. They are all sessile (non-moving or staying in one place) as adults. Most sea squirt species are common coastal animals, occurring in rock pools and out into deeper water to about 400 metres depth.

WebAbout. This colony of sea squirts looks like a bunch of beautiful flower petals stuck next to each other to form a mosaic of stars. It takes 3-12 individuals to produce one of the star-shaped patterns.
